Lauren Mitchell hails from Bradenton, Florida. In 2021 Ms Mitchell relocated to New Orleans, Louisiana to expand her musical knowledge and influences. In August 2022, she recorded as a guest vocalist with The Count Basie Orchestra for their 2024 Grammy Winning Album “Basie Swings The Blues”, alongside vocalists Keb’ Mo, Carmen Bradford, Bobby Rush, and Bettye LaVette, among others. Scotty Barnhart, Director of The Count Basie Orchestra, has said that “Lauren is one of the most important blues artists working today.”

Prior to 2020, Lauren was sharing her gifts with audiences all around the U.S., and even internationally for a January 2019 performance at the Havana Jazz Festival in Cuba! From 2016 to 2019, Lauren and her band travelled the United States on several lengthy tours that had her sharing the stage with Buddy Guy, Danielle Nicole and Lurrie Bell. Her 2017 release, "Desire" was recorded in Los Angeles with Grammy Award Winning producer Tony Braunagel (Bonnie Raitt, Taj Mahal, Robert Cray). That album garnered her two Blues Blast Award Nominations, and was ranked the #6 Soul Blues Album on the Roots Music Report for 2017.

“Desire” also earned high praise from the Blues/Soul/Roots community, including a omparison to the late Etta James by two-time Grammy Award Winner Josh Sklair, guitarist, producer, and music director for the last 25 years of Etta's career. Ms Mitchell has been on the rise since the release of her first album,"Please Come Home" in 2013, which was followed by a 2014 win to represent the Suncoast Blues Society in Memphis at the International Blues Challenge. Lauren's second album "Live! From the Bradfordville Blues Club" (2014), was also chosen in 2015 as the entry for Best Self-Produced Album at the 2015 IBC by the Suncoast Blues Society.
